Hi,
Although I have reorganized all my channels in the way I feel best... I have always wanted them to be numbered the same as V*r*in... 101 BBC, etc.. I was told that this could only be done using Channel Mapping (not available on Eurovox)... however.... If you created channels 1 to 999, could you not assign BBC One to 101 and skip all the channels from 1 to 100? This woul mean that the first channel in your system would be 101 .. then continue with this process until all channels are the same as V*r*in??? This feature is available in the channel reorder in menu system ... not sure about Voxer... Any thoughts on this? Thanks |

It can be done like this CDF Files for the Eurovox but you need to do them one at a time with voxer, its about 3 or 4 keystrokes per blank entry & you will soon have the routine off to a fine art, it should take 2 to 3 hrs to complete & its well worth it (I use Tivo to record).

Right.. so I have added all the blank channels (using a macro program and only took about 10 minutes).. now I have all my channels in order as V*R*IN.. i.e. 101 BBC One ... 102 BBC Two.. 103 ITV One.. 511 Sky Sports One etc... All looks good and working however..
I'm using VOXER 2.1.0.70 which I believe is the newest however when you push skip channel in voxer.. it doesn't save when you send it to the eurovox.. i have tried sending direct from the Voxer program and also saving and sending via UFL... any suggestion as skipping channels manually through the remote will take a long time..
